Lauren Halsted has a plan: build a school

 and  get it running. She doesn’t have time for distractions. Building/renovating that school means she’ll need an architect, and when she literally falls into Matt Walsh’s warms while inspecting a building to buy, she knows she is in trouble. She won’t let him deviate her from her plan – but he’s absolutely irresistible. She’ll run… but he will be right behind chasing her.

The first in The Walsh Family series, this is not only Matt and Lauren’s love story but also great introduction to the family who runs a sustainable preservations architectural firm in Boston. We meet all the brothers and the sisters, as well as their horrible father. 

These books are interconnected with other series, so we also hear get a glimpse of the Commodore (he’s Lauren’s father) and Nick Acevedo, the doctor, who’s Matt’s best friend.

An excellent kickstart to the series! Off to book #2!

Narration: why oh why did Christian Fox stop narrating? I know he’s focusing on his acting and musical career, but he’s sooooo good! He’s paired in this with Lucy Rivers, another amazing narrator.

Possible triggers: toxic relationship with a parent; homophobia (a slur is used on page by a secondary character); death of a parent
